Ight heres run down.

The car has a boost limit on the first 2-3 gears. The power falls off so sharply because the ECU slowly closes the throttle plate after Peak power to the point that when you get to 6000 rpms its at only 30%. I raced a memeber on here Mrcheeks he's a stock cobalt running a supertune similar to the one i had on my cobalt. he dyno'd 225/200 on that same dyno. We did digs and rolls.......

DEAD EVEN


untill i shift to 5th then i start to walk away from him like it wasn't even a race. The first time it happened i was upset that we were so even then when I pulled away so quickly I had to ask him if he missed a gear? he said "No you just ran away all in a sudden" This car is weird man theres so much ECU nanny control crap on it you really can't do proper work till 5th gear which i start at like 95 miles perhour.
